Commonwealth Games 2014: Indian Powerlifter Sakina Khatun Wins Bronze
Indian powerlifter Sakina Khatun lifted a total weight of 88.2 kg to finish third in the women's lightweight (up to 61kg) category, giving India their first medal on day 10 of the 2014 Commonwealth Games in Glasgow.

Glasgow:
Indian powerlifter Sakina Khatun won the bronze in the women's lightweight (up to 61kg) category to give the country its first medal of day 10 of the 2014 Commonwealth Games here Saturday. (Day 10 updates)
Sakina lifted a total weight of 88.2 kg to finish third. (Medal tally)

Esther Oyema (136kg) of Nigeria took home the gold while England's Natalie Blake took home the silver with a 100.2kg lift.

India with the latest addition of this medal take their tally to 52, including 13 golds, 23 silvers and 16 bronzes. The Games conclude on Sunday.
